Research on smokers who have quit shows that

a. once a smoker quits, he or she is unlikely to relapse.
b. people go through stages in their readiness to quit.
c. most of those who have quit have used professional treatment programs.
d. all current smokers are psychologically equivalent in terms of their willingness to quit.


Answer: b. people go through stages in their readiness to quit.
